It was a very nice end to a somewhat heartbreaking weekend. Spending time with my family for Father's Day reminded me how the base of stability I relied upon while growing up is slowly eroding. I have been truly blessed with a family whose members are all very reasonable, caring, understanding people who actually get along well with each other. The heartbreaking part is seeing my 92 year-old grandmother, with whom I am very close, slowly deteriorate. This was the first time in almost three months that I went home to visit and I feel horrible about that fact - it's only a three hour drive. I should go back this weekend.
